Default Red light coming on

Hey guys I have a 2004 1000rr. When the bike was running, the red light came on two times (solid not flashing). The first time it went off after I let off the throttle. The second time it came on and stayed on until I shut the bike off and restarted it.

When I turn the key and the bike is still off, the red light comes on, I don't remember if that's normal or not but I don't remember it ever coming on.

Any idea what could be causing this?

If you are refering to the oil indicator, it means you have low oil pressure. The light being on with just the key on and not running is normal as you dont have any oil pressure, so the light is on. It should go off as soon as the bike starts and builds pressure.

I'm not sure why it would be on during riding though. It could be a faulty sensor or the engine is actually experiencing low oil pressure which is not good. If it comes on again during your ride, it might be worth a trip to the dealership and have them check the pressure switch to make sure its functioning properly.

For anyone else reading this, check your battery cables. Loose battery cables caused it.
